Purchased second vehicle from Red Deer motors January 2016. Talked into "Extended Warranty package" (approx $1500) as it "covers EVERYTHING bumper-to-bumper". Asked about basics: parts, towing, stranded... was reassured that I would have "NO issues for 36 months....Only thing I had to concern myself with was regular maintenance: Oil Changes, Flushes... Reimbursed when stranded... blah blah blah" More than I wanted to pay, but agreed, based on information told.
Fast forward 11 months later; broken down vehicle in Calgary with my 10 year old son, in -30 weather. Contacted " AMAZING Warranty Company"
WELL... information was COMPLETELY misleading. Had to arrange OWN tow back to Red Deer; cost of being stuck in Calgary hotel for 2 days NOT reimbursed as we were 158kms from destination and their requirement is 160kms. Yes, 2 KILOMETERS! 2... apparently when you are 158kms in the middle of winter, you should be able to push your vehicle to your destination. Due to terrible weather, [redacted] (AMAZING PEOPLE!) was dealing with 12-36 hour response times; even longer for us as tow was from Calgary to Red Deer.
So, in the end, there is NO coverage what-so-ever for repairs or emergency accommodations. Warranty rep handling claim keeps talking about "vehicle hitting a deer" - though there is NO body damage, and no way to hit a deer when vehicle could not move. Although Warranty fine print states that they will cover rental car up to $75/day while vehicle is in repair shop; this too was shut down as while stuck in Calgary, there were NO repair shops open for vehicle to be at. (Saturday, December 10th & Sunday, December 11th); and if there WERE repair shops open, there was no available tow trucks to have vehicle taken in until after Midnight Monday, December 12th.
Contacted Red Deer Motors who refuse to offer any assistance. No longer their problem; vehicle was not there concern as of January 9th, 2016 when it left their lot.
A previous repeat customer who will NEVER deal with this dealership again, nor recommend anyone does.
I will note, after repeat calls to "manager" of Red Deer Motors stating very unhappy former customer, he did arrange a "discount" on a battery in Red Deer for me to pick up and have installed at my expense. So, thank you, for the $10 discount on what will be at least a $1500+++ expense. (if we are lucky)
